What the Fog Light Indicator Means on a Ford Transit Custom

The fog light indicator on a Ford Transit Custom simply confirms your front and/or rear fog lights are switched on. It is an informational (usually green for front, amber for rear) telltale, not a fault.

Professional Mechanic Tips

Field notes from Marcus Vale, ASE-Certified Master Technician
Rear fogs on a Ford Transit Custom are dazzling to others — only use them in genuine fog and switch them off the moment visibility improves.
